Java打开文件xlsx是指使用Java语言来操作和读取xlsx格式的文件。xlsx是一种电子表格文件格式,常用于存储和处理数据。下面是完善且全面的答案:
概念:
xlsx文件是Microsoft Excel软件的一种文件格式,它使用了基于XML的开放文件格式标准,可以存储大量的数据,并且支持多种数据类型和格式。
分类:
xlsx文件是一种二进制文件,属于Office Open XML(OOXML)文件格式的一种。它是一种电子表格文件,可以包含多个工作表(sheet),每个工作表可以有多个行和列。
优势:
- 跨平台兼容性:xlsx文件可以在不同操作系统和不同设备上进行读取和编辑,确保了数据的可移植性和跨平台兼容性。
- 数据存储容量大:xlsx文件格式支持存储大量的数据,可以处理复杂的数据计算和分析任务。
- 数据类型丰富:xlsx文件支持多种数据类型,包括文本、数字、日期、公式等,可以满足不同数据处理需求。
- 数据格式化和样式:xlsx文件可以添加数据格式化和样式,包括字体、颜色、边框等,使数据更加美观和易于阅读。
- 安全性:xlsx文件支持密码保护和权限控制,可以对文件进行加密和限制访问,确保数据的安全性和机密性。
应用场景:
- 数据分析和报表生成:xlsx文件可以存储和处理大量的数据,适用于数据分析和生成各种报表。
- 业务数据管理:xlsx文件可用于存储和管理各种业务数据,如客户信息、销售数据、库存数据等。
- 文件导出和导入:xlsx文件常用于数据导出和导入,可以方便地将数据从一个系统迁移到另一个系统。
- 数据交换和共享:xlsx文件是一种常用的数据交换和共享格式,可以与其他系统和软件进行数据交互。
推荐的腾讯云相关产品和产品介绍链接地址:
腾讯云提供了多个与云计算和数据处理相关的产品和服务,以下是其中一些产品,供参考:
- 腾讯云对象存储(COS):用于存储和管理大量的文件和数据,支持高可靠性和高可扩展性,适合存储和管理xlsx文件。链接地址:https://cloud.tencent.com/product/cos
- 腾讯云云数据库MySQL:提供稳定可靠的MySQL数据库服务,可用于存储和管理与xlsx文件相关的数据。链接地址:https://cloud.tencent.com/product/cdb_mysql
- 腾讯云云函数(SCF):无服务器函数计算服务,可用于编写和运行与xlsx文件相关的数据处理和计算逻辑。链接地址:https://cloud.tencent.com/product/scf
- 腾讯云人工智能(AI)服务:提供丰富的人工智能算法和API,可用于与xlsx文件相关的数据分析和处理任务。链接地址:https://cloud.tencent.com/product/ai_services
请注意,以上只是推荐的腾讯云产品,其他云计算品牌商也提供了类似的产品和服务,可根据具体需求选择合适的云计算平台和工具。